Is there a specific meaning associated with the name Johnna?
The name Johnna is derived from the name John, which means 'God is gracious.' This gives Johnna a sense of grace and favor, making it a meaningful choice for many parents. The name embodies qualities of kindness and benevolence, reflecting its roots.

Is Johnna a unisex name?
No, Johnna is typically considered a feminine name. While John is a well-known masculine name, Johnna is specifically used for females, distinguishing it from its male counterpart. This gender distinction is important in understanding the name's usage.
